South Mcdougal Lake sits at a C on the grading scale — not impaired, not pristine, with summer measurements that vary year to year. Clarity is the limiting factor — phosphorus is reasonable but suspended particles or algal cells keep water transparency below Minnesota norms.
At a TSI of 60, South Mcdougal Lake reads as eutrophic — nutrient-rich enough that summer algal growth and reduced clarity are expected, not unusual. A maximum depth of just 7 ft means sediment-bound phosphorus releases back into the water column whenever wind stirs the bottom — a classic shallow-lake dynamic. South Mcdougal Lake covers 287 acres alongside 5.8 miles of shoreline — a mid-sized water that supports a working fishery without being so large that conditions diverge between basins. South Mcdougal Lake ranks 135 of 159 in Lake County — at the lower end of the locally monitored distribution.
No invasive species are currently listed at South Mcdougal Lake — the lake remains off the Minnesota infested-waters roster. Walleye are documented at South Mcdougal Lake, one of 6 fish species on record for the lake. No formal public access is documented at South Mcdougal Lake — most use is by shoreline residents and their guests. Monitoring depth is thin here: the LakeGrade rubric is applied to a small number of sample years, and the grade will be revised as more data accumulates.
